Daimler Trucks Recalls 2019-2020 Vehicles for Brake Caliper Bolt Issue

Daimler Trucks North America is recalling 2,585 2019-2020 trucks because brake caliper mounting bolts may be loose, increasing crash risk.

Plain-English summary

Daimler Trucks North America LLC (DTNA) is recalling 2,585 model year 2019-2020 vehicles equipped with air disc brakes. The affected models include Freightliner 108SD, 114SD, Cascadia, Business Class M2, Western Star 4700 and 5700, and various Freightliner Custom Chassis (FCCC) models.

The recall is due to brake caliper mounting bolts that may have been insufficiently tightened. Loose bolts can reduce brake effectiveness, which increases the risk of a crash.

DTNA will notify owners, and dealers will inspect and repair the vehicles free of charge. The recall began on May 1, 2020. Owners can contact DTNA customer service at 1-800-547-0712 or the NHTSA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236.
